W10.3
Joe has borrowed £1125.
While Joe is a college, simple interest is added to this amount at a rate of 5% per year.
Calculate the total amount Joe will owe after two years at college.
Back
Hint:
Careful!!! in Functional Skills Level 1 we only see simple interest. They don't wok like most of the intersts we deal in our lives.
Watch the video if needed.
A simple interest in calculated once from the amount of money borrowed and the mount stay the same and is added year on year for the lenght of the loan.

answer:
Without a calculator:
5% of 1125 is:
10 % then ÷ 2 = 5%
112.5 ÷ 2 = 56.25
for two years 56.25 x 2 = 112.5
Total owe= 112.5 + 1125 = 1237.5
£ 1237.50 (£ sign in front and two decimals)
with a calculator:
1125 x 0.05 = 56.25
then it's the same
